Gorgonzola is a veined blue cheese, originally from Italy, made from unskimmed cow's milk. It can be buttery and quite salty, with a "bite" from its blue veining. This dolce or "sweet" version of this cheese is a good introduction for anyone who has not tried to make blue cheese before and is also known as Dolcelatte or Cremifacato. It is light on the bite and milder than Gorgonzola Piccante.
